Episode 46: Cybernetics

Episode 46: Cybernetics

Nathan Gilmour moderates a LONG discussion of cybernetics, those relationships between humanity and technology that define everyday existence. Our conversation ranges from ancient philosophies of technology to movie and comic book bad guys to modern philosophical engagements with the character of technology. Among the artifacts and writers we touch on are Plato, Paul, Edgar Allen Poe, Darth Vader, Captain Hook, Kobo Abe, Neil Postman, Martin Heidegger, and Genesis.
